What is Vishay Precision Group's net change in cash?
Vishay Precision Group (VPG) reported net change in cash of -$4.88M in Q1 2026.
How has Vishay Precision Group's net change in cash changed year-over-year?
Vishay Precision Group's net change in cash decreased by 205.6% year-over-year, from $4.62M to -$4.88M.
What does net change in cash mean?
Total increase or decrease in cash during the period — the sum of operating, investing, financing cash flows plus FX effects.
